REDSHIRT JUNIOR (2020-21)
- 2021 NCAA Qualifier (No. 6 seed) at 133 pounds
- 2021 MAC Champion (133 pounds)
- Wrestled to an impressive 12-3 record in his first year as a Tiger
- Picked up three ranked wins during the regular season, highlighted by back-to-back dominant performances, winning in a 12-0 major decision against No. 7, Oregon State’s Devan Turner (Jan. 3) and in a 11-1 major decision against No. 14, Central Michigan’s Andrew Marten (Jan. 8)
- Tallied four victories en route to winning an individual MAC championship, Feb. 26-27, at 133 pounds, including 18-2 and 22-5 technical falls
- Completed season as a quarterfinal finisher at the NCAA Championships (March 18-20) after picking up two victories at the national tournament

BEFORE MIZZOU
- Graduate transfer 133-pounder from West Virginia
- Former team captain for the Mountaineers, will have two years of eligibility remaining as he took a redshirt as a freshman and an Olympic redshirt last season
- In his final year wrestling with WVU, he battled through an elbow injury to earn the No. 16 national seed at the NCAA Championships at 133 pounds
- Won his opening-round matchup at NCAAs, but was ousted from the championship by top-seeded Daton Fix (Oklahoma State) and then lost in his first bout in the consolation rounds. In all, he posted a 19-10 record as a RS sophomore.
- As a redshirt freshman in 2017-18, he posted a 23-14 record and boasted a top-20 rank nationally throughout the entire season.
- Placed fourth at a loaded Big 12 Conference Championship tournament, earning an automatic berth to the NCAA Championships
- At the 2018 NCAA Championships, he went 2-2 despite having to face top-seeded Seth Gross (SDSU) in the opening round
- Was 42-24 overall in his two-year career
- Was a two-time Academic All-Big 12 Second Team selection while at WVU as well
High School
- At Platte City High School, Schmitt was a three-time MSHSAA Class 3 State Champion and the 2015 Class 3 Wrestler of the Year.
- Eight-time Fargo All-American and a USJOC Champion as well.
